Correct Cutting Practices
Effective pruning techniques are crucial for promoting the health and longevity of trees. Correct pruning encourages healthy growth by cutting away dead or diseased branches, which can host pests and diseases. It also enhances air circulation and sunlight penetration, critical factors for a tree's vitality. Furthermore, strategic pruning shapes the tree, enhancing its structural integrity and lowering the risk of branch failure. Professional tree services are furnished with the knowledge and tools to perform precise cuts, guaranteeing minimal damage to the tree. They recognize the specific needs of different species and the ideal times for pruning, enhancing recovery and growth. Typical DIY Tree Care Mistakes to Avoid
A lot of homeowners initiate DIY tree care with excellent intentions, but many common mistakes can weaken their efforts. One prevalent error involves improper watering; too much or too little water can cause root rot or dehydration, respectively. Additionally, many people forget to research the specific needs of their tree species, producing poor care.
One typical mistake is employing unsuitable tools for tree upkeep, leading to inadequate cuts or damage to the tree. Inadequate monitoring for pests and diseases additionally presents a considerable risk, as prompt discovery is vital for management.
Moreover, several homeowners insightful guide misjudge the importance of safety gear, omitting protective gear while executing tree work. Furthermore, aggressive pruning can be destructive, as it may eliminate vital foliage and compromise the tree. Evading these typical pitfalls can result in healthier trees and a more beautiful landscape.

Leaning Tree Inspection
Leaning trees can pose significant hazards to both property and safety, making their inspection an essential aspect of landscape management. When trees lean excessively, they may indicate structural weaknesses or root instability, raising the risk of falling during storms or high winds. Property owners should regularly evaluate their trees for signs of leaning, particularly after heavy rainfall or strong winds, as these conditions can exacerbate the problem. Professional tree services employ specialized techniques to evaluate the health of leaning trees, offering insights into potential risks. They can recommend remedial actions, such as cabling or bracing, to stabilize the tree or, if necessary, advise on safe removal. Regular inspection ensures a safer landscape and protects investments in property and surroundings.
Expired or Dying Leaves
Dead or dying foliage may signal underlying issues affecting the health of trees on a property. Color changes, wilting, or untimely leaf fall are typical signs of stress and potential disease. Trees might also show dieback, where branches commence losing vitality, often due to environmental factors or pest infestations. Property owners need to watch for these signs, as they can result in additional decline if left unaddressed. Moreover, dead branches create hazardous conditions, especially during storms or high winds. Engaging professional tree services can provide expert assessment and remedial measures to restore tree health. Detecting and managing dead or dying foliage early is critical to preserving a vibrant landscape and avoiding dangers that may impact surrounding plants or property.
Root System Damage Analysis
Though many homeowners recognize the beauty of trees, they might disregard the necessity of examining root health, which contributes an integral part in the total stability and strength of the landscape. Root damage can lead to significant hazards, including tree instability and potential property damage. Typical signs of root problems consist of noticeable fissures in the ground, tilting trees, and faded leaves. Homeowners need to be attentive to these warnings, because they may suggest impaired root systems stemming from pathogens, pests, or environmental factors. Professional tree services can conduct thorough root damage assessments, providing expertise in identifying underlying problems and recommending appropriate solutions. This preventive strategy helps ensure a more robust landscape and minimizes the likelihood of hazardous tree collapses.

How Frequently Should I Arrange Tree Services for Maintenance?
Professionals suggest scheduling tree services at least one time annually for maintenance. However, depending on tree species, age, and local climate conditions, more regular visits may be beneficial to ensure optimal health and growth.
What Credentials Should I Look for When Choosing a Tree Service Business?
When choosing a tree service company, one should consider certifications, insurance coverage, experience, and customer reviews. Moreover, validating conformity to industry standards and acquiring written estimates will ensure excellence and dependability in their services.
Do Tree Care Companies Have Insurance and What Does It Protect?
The majority of reputable tree services carry insurance, which typically provides protection for liability for property damage and worker injuries. This insurance guarantees that clients are protected from financial burden in case of accidents during tree care services.
How Do I Determine if a Tree Service Is Trustworthy?
To establish if a tree service is trustworthy, you should check for proper licenses, insurance, customer feedback, and professional affiliations. Moreover, requesting multiple quotes can give details regarding their credibility and quality of service.
What Is the Standard Cost of Professional Tree Services?
The typical cost for professional tree services ranges from $200 to $1,500, varying with factors including tree size, location, and service type. Property owners should get multiple quotes to verify quality service and fair pricing.
